Pleasantly surprised!! Had planned on going to the Plume of Feathers but it was heaving and my partner and I had been traveling all day so wanted a nice dinner. Drove down the road to the next pub and found the Rose and Crown, asked if they did food and were told yes. Barman was training another member of staff with the drinks - being kind and supportive as they spoke. £8 for an IPA and a shandy. Sat down and looked at menu, it looked awful! Choice of burgers, lasagne, scampi, fish goujons, all day brekkie, ham - egg - chips or pie of the day ...but printed on a laminated A4 piece of paper with bent corners, looking really uninspiring. For half our pints we'd committed to look elsewhere for food but the match was on and we couldn't be bothered to drive anymore so took our chances. Ham - egg - chips + chicken and mushroom pie, £23. Both arrived hot and looking amazing. Pie had plenty of filling and with good quality meat (I'm very squeamish with meat, any fatty bits/ veins and I'm not touching it!!) Big portions too! Chef brought them out and was very polite. Really pleased we stayed and took a chance after the unpromising looking menu. Don't let it put you off! Staff and regulars all said farewell. We will definitely be back again soon.
